Summary
The Shibboleth WordPress plugin before version 2.5.4 does not fail closed when its HTTP header identity mode is enabled without an anti-spoofing key, treating any request carrying identity headers as an authenticated session without verifying them.
Risk Assessment
On a deployment where untrusted client headers reach the application, an unauthenticated attacker can log in with forged identity headers. With automatic account creation and default administrator role mapping enabled, they can create and sign in as a new administrator, gaining full control.
Recommendation
Immediately update the Shibboleth plugin to version 2.5.4 or later. Additionally, configure an anti-spoofing key for the HTTP header mode and ensure untrusted client headers are stripped before reaching the application.

Original NVD description (English source)
The Shibboleth WordPress plugin before 2.5.4 does not fail closed when its HTTP header identity mode is enabled without an anti-spoofing key, treating any request that carries identity headers as an authenticated session without verifying them. On a deployment where untrusted client headers reach the application, an unauthenticated attacker can log in with forged identity headers and, when automatic account creation and the default administrator role mapping are enabled, create and sign in as a new administrator. Exploitation requires the non-default HTTP header attribute mode, an empty or absent spoof key, automatic account creation enabled, and a deployment that does not strip untrusted client headers before they reach the application.
